Amblyopia. Anisometropia is a condition in which a person's eyes have substantially differing refractive power. [ 1] Generally, a difference in power of one diopter (1D) is the threshold for diagnosis of the condition. Entoptic phenomena (from Ancient Greek ἐντός (entós) 'within' and ὀπτικός (optikós) 'visual') are visual effects whose source is within the human eye itself. For Your Eyes Only. For Your Eyes Only is a collection of short stories by the British author Ian Fleming, featuring the fictional British Secret Service agent Commander James Bond, the eighth book to feature the character. It was first published by Jonathan Cape on 11 April 1960.

Rheum (/ r uː m /; from Greek: ῥεῦμα rheuma 'a flowing, rheum') is a thin mucus naturally discharged from the eyes, nose, or mouth, often during sleep (contrast with mucopurulent discharge). [1] [2] [3] Rheum dries and gathers as a crust in the corners of the eyes or the mouth, on the eyelids, or under the nose. [3]
A distant object is defined as an object located beyond 6 meters (20 feet) from the eye. When an object is located close to the eye, the rays of light from this object no longer approach the eye parallel to each other. Consequently, the eye must increase its refractive power to bring those rays of light together on the retina.
